Career
Captain James Green began his law enforcement career in 1987. Of those years serving as a supervisor. Green is responsible for the community and judicial services divisions of the Orangeburg County Sheriff’s Office. For the past nine years, Green has served the people of Orangeburg County as:
- Crime Prevention and Gang Specialist
- Field Services Deputy
- Supervisor of the School Resource Officers
Captain Green is one of our primary public speakers as he is charged with conducting education seminars on crime prevention and gangs, as well as conducting citizen academies to foster a interactive and cooperative relationship with citizens.
Education
He is a magna cum laude graduate of Claflin University with a Bachelor of Science in Sociology/Criminal Justice Administration.
